diff options
author | Daniel Kirchner <daniel@ekpyron.org> | 2018-08-16 06:39:19 +0800 |
---|---|---|
committer | Daniel Kirchner <daniel@ekpyron.org> | 2018-09-04 19:31:10 +0800 |
commit | 0011f8aef9ef949fc971fceed2e319adb6a58ec1 (patch) | |
tree | 2f23a3b638973383f10275ddfaca8af52719b13c /test/compilationTests/MultiSigWallet/MultiSigWallet.sol | |
parent | 82f512a7d40a3bd6a13dd799be66dd164fded077 (diff) | |
download | dexon-solidity-0011f8aef9ef949fc971fceed2e319adb6a58ec1.tar dexon-solidity-0011f8aef9ef949fc971fceed2e319adb6a58ec1.tar.gz dexon-solidity-0011f8aef9ef949fc971fceed2e319adb6a58ec1.tar.bz2 dexon-solidity-0011f8aef9ef949fc971fceed2e319adb6a58ec1.tar.lz dexon-solidity-0011f8aef9ef949fc971fceed2e319adb6a58ec1.tar.xz dexon-solidity-0011f8aef9ef949fc971fceed2e319adb6a58ec1.tar.zst dexon-solidity-0011f8aef9ef949fc971fceed2e319adb6a58ec1.zip |
Update compilation tests.
Diffstat (limited to 'test/compilationTests/MultiSigWallet/MultiSigWallet.sol')
-rw-r--r-- | test/compilationTests/MultiSigWallet/MultiSigWallet.sol |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/test/compilationTests/MultiSigWallet/MultiSigWallet.sol b/test/compilationTests/MultiSigWallet/MultiSigWallet.sol index 35f6208b..dc6e98e4 100644 --- a/test/compilationTests/MultiSigWallet/MultiSigWallet.sol +++ b/test/compilationTests/MultiSigWallet/MultiSigWallet.sol @@ -226,13 +226,11 @@ contract MultiSigWallet { { if (isConfirmed(transactionId)) { Transaction storage tx = transactions[transactionId]; - tx.executed = true; - if (tx.destination.call.value(tx.value)(tx.data)) + (tx.executed,) = tx.destination.call.value(tx.value)(tx.data); + if (tx.executed) emit Execution(transactionId); - else { + else emit ExecutionFailure(transactionId); - tx.executed = false; - } } } |